Remy’s Ratatouille Adventure Transitions from Virtual Queue to Standby Line Next Week

Beginning Monday, January 10th, guests wishing to ride Remy’s Ratatouille Adventure in EPCOT will no longer gain access to the attraction via virtual queue. A standby line will be used for the EPCOT attraction starting Monday. Guests who don’t want to wait in line for Remy’s can purchase Individual Lightning Lane access if they wish.
